The global Tofacitinib Tablets market is poised for substantial expansion, propelled by the rising incidence of autoimmune diseases such as rheumatoid arthritis, ulcerative colitis, and psoriasis. This growth is underpinned by the drug's proven efficacy in managing these chronic conditions, offering enhanced patient quality of life. The market encompasses various dosage strengths and packaging configurations to meet diverse therapeutic requirements.


Projections indicate a market size of $3.42 billion in 2025, with an anticipated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 13.5% through 2033. Market dynamics will be shaped by factors including biosimilar introductions, evolving pricing strategies, and the emergence of novel treatment paradigms.


Geographically, North America and Europe currently dominate market share due to high healthcare spending and robust awareness of autoimmune disorders. However, the Asia-Pacific region and other emerging markets are expected to exhibit accelerated growth, driven by improving healthcare infrastructure and increasing disease prevalence.
The competitive arena features key players like Pfizer, alongside numerous contributors to the Tofacitinib Tablets supply chain.
Further segmentation analysis suggests Rheumatoid Arthritis as the leading application, followed by Ulcerative Colitis and Psoriasis. The availability of varied tablet packaging underscores market maturity and adaptability to patient needs.
Despite potential challenges such as managing side effects and the introduction of competing therapies, the significant positive impact on patient outcomes and the persistent prevalence of target diseases point to a strong growth outlook for Tofacitinib Tablets. Future market trajectory will be influenced by clinical innovations, regulatory advancements, and the ongoing development of alternative treatment options.

Despite the significant growth potential, several factors pose challenges to the tofacitinib tablets market. The high cost of treatment is a major barrier for many patients, especially in regions with limited healthcare access or insurance coverage. Potential side effects associated with tofacitinib, such as infections and blood clots, require careful monitoring and management, which adds to the overall cost and complexity of treatment. The emergence of biosimilar competition is putting downward pressure on prices and profit margins for original manufacturers. Stringent regulatory approvals and safety concerns can delay market entry for new formulations or therapeutic applications. Furthermore, the development of alternative therapeutic options for autoimmune diseases poses a threat to tofacitinib's market share. The fluctuating prices of raw materials needed for tofacitinib production can also impact the overall profitability of the market. Finally, healthcare systems' varying reimbursement policies and the complexity of navigating regulatory pathways in different countries represent further barriers to widespread adoption.
